ManheimFowles First Ever Public Auction a Huge Success
ManheimFowles first ever public auction has been a huge success, with over 200 people attending the Auckland auction last Saturday. The auction is the first of many, with ManheimFowles launching new weekly public auctions every Saturday commencing at 12 noon.
The Auckland facility was abuzz with crowds interested in finding a car that suited both their needs and their budget. ManheimFowles staff were kept busy with enquiries about the cars on offer and how to buy at auction. The auction itself was action packed with spirited bidding and buying keeping the gavel busy all day. Being the weekend, there was also entertainment provided to keep the kids occupied.
Alan Roderick, General Manager of ManheimFowles New Zealand, said “We are absolutely delighted with the response to our first ever public auction. With 50 cars sold and over 200 people in attendance, the result is very pleasing. Excitement levels were sky-high and you could really sense the crowd’s anticipation and our budget conscious buyers certainly were not disappointed”.
“While we are not the largest auction house in New Zealand we do pride ourselves on being absolutely the best! We are totally focused on offering the public the best customer focused auction experience and I encourage anyone looking for a used vehicle to come down and try their hand at our Saturday Public Auctions. I am sure that even if they don’t find the car they are looking for they will still find the experience enjoyable”.
